Position Summary

The successful candidate for this position will play a pivotal role in formulating and executing a strategy to shape the access policy environment to ensure patients have access to BMS medicines...An enthusiastic access or policy professional, they will be motivated by the goal of improving the lives of patients through enhancing access to medicines and contributing to the wider health policy environment...They will engage with policymakers, stakeholders and partners with the ultimate aim of fostering a pro-innovation environment and optimizing patient access to innovative therapies...Reporting to the Global Policy and Access Lead, they will lead a team of talented individuals with responsibilities spanning the access policy environment and BMS key areas of therapeutic focus including oncology, hematology, immunology and cardiovascular disease...

Key Responsibilities

  • Prepare, champion and execute activities to shape the ICON / Japan access policy environment to support patient access to BMS medicines.
  • Develop specific strategies and activities to shape how national and EU level HTA bodies, assess medicines, advocating for processes and methods that support timely access to BMS medicines.
  • Monitor, engage and shape policies that impact the price of BMS medicines in EU/ICON regions (including International Reference Pricing), horizon scanning external trends in the policy environment to elevate policy risks and opportunities to the BMS Global Policy council.
  • Drive BMS external engagement and positioning on efficient and sustainable Health expenditure policies, monitoring cost containment initiatives and working with market colleagues to proactively engage with the political debate, legislation and national policies.
